  12. It's far more durable than paint, well, in a traditional paint. There are very hard paints that are heat-cured like powder coating and they are also electrostatic applied. You typically see these on OEM wheels. If you are going to have them coated, they will strip them down to bare metal first. You can only powder coat over powder and it has to be done right after the first coat, so you would have bare metal-powder-cure-cool-powder-cure. I don't know how much abuse your wheels will see, but I've had great success with normal spray paint (enamel) on wheels. IT's cheap and easy to touch-up if anything happens. Hell, scuff your wheels now, go grab several cans of paint, paint the wheels and see how it lasts. IT may cost you $30 and some time, but you may find it a cheap alternative to powder coating which could easily run $100+ per wheel. IT also give you the ability to easily touch up whenever you need.
